Solution

The correct option is C 1.86×103L
At NTP conditions, 1 mole of a gas occupies 22.4 L of volume. So, for combustion of 1 kg of coal

number of mole of coal=100012=83.333moles we will require 83.333moles of oxygen (O2) which is occupies =83.333×22.4

=1.866×103 L of volume of NTP.
